PLN Gets Involved Related to Powerless Monas Lift

Jakarta Provincial Government will coordinate with State-owned electricity firm (PLN) regarding elevator disruption at National Monument (Monas) on Sunday (5/4). The lift stoppage was caused by lack of electricity supply.

Head of Jakarta Tourism and Culture Dept, Arie Budhiman said, the stoppage of Monas elevator is not because of broken, but due to lacks of electricity. “I have discuss it with the technician, and the incident was caused by low supply,” Budhiman said, Monday (5/5).

Budhiman asserted, preventing similar incident happens again, he and Monas Management Unit will coordinate with Department of Energy and Industry and PLN.

Meanwhile, Management Unit (UP) of Monas guarantee that the lift can operate again normally. “The lift is go back to normal. The incident just happened for a half hour,” Rini said.

He also send direct apology to Monas visitors due to this uncomfortable incident. Technicians would be prepared to quickly solve the matter if similar incident occurs.

A moment ago, reparation for Monas lift had been finished. So far, the maintenance is still going which done by tender winner. On the weekend, the lift must load more visitor than in usual day. Lift maintenance also needs stable power supply.
